You're free to think what you like about the man, but through all his innocence, he hit on something that resonates with me and many others. The earliest time I ever heard his music was during the Vietnam War. Country Roads was something all the people I knew wanted to hear over and over. That and Rocky Mountain High, for those of us from that part of the country, were a reminder of our home. The Colorado Rockies were my "country roads" and still are today. John was not from here, but he integrated readily. I have no problem with his music representing the way I feel about my home. One thing I have yet to do is visit Williams Lake, Colorado, during the annual Perseid meteor shower. I also want to see the fire in the sky.
